Better Health for All
-70
The company's core business of asphalt production and road construction has significant negative health impacts. Inhaling respirable crystalline silica during asphalt milling can cause silicosis, lung cancer, COPD, and renal disease.
1
Additionally, asphalt emits volatile organic compounds (VOCs) that can lead to respiratory irritation, neurological disorders, cardiovascular issues, and are potential carcinogens.
2
Given that the company specializes in these activities, nearly all of its revenue is derived from products and activities with well-established negative health outcomes. The company's safety record indicates notable safety incidents, with its Total Recordable Incident Rate (TRIR) at 2.0 for 2020, which is higher than the industry average of 1.7.
3
The company's operations generate significant health-harming externalities, with 3.2 million deaths annually linked to VOC exposure.
4
While the company uses warm-mix asphalt to reduce emissions and recycles asphalt pavement, these are partial remediation efforts.
5
The company emphasizes preventative measures to reduce silica dust exposure, including a ten-year collaborative effort and NIOSH grant support for developing controls.
6
It also highlights the importance of clear operator manuals and training materials for workers to understand risks and controls, but risk disclosures are incomplete.
7
The company's R&D and capital allocation are not primarily focused on health outcomes, with no specific data on investment in health-related research or mitigation efforts beyond dust control.

Fair Pay & Worker Respect
-20
For the fiscal year ended September 30, 2024, the ratio of the Chief Executive Officer’s pay to that of the median employee was 64.6 to 1.
1
The company is not subject to any collective bargaining agreements with respect to any of its employees as of September 30, 2025.
2
In October 2025, a subsidiary executed a consent decree with the EPA regarding Clean Water Act violations, agreeing to pay a civil penalty of $450,000 and remediate the conditions.
